Show infoHistory of American Music is an overview of, primarily, American Music starting just after 1900 and reaching the present day w/a core focus from 1919-1969. The show has a strong jazz and African-American music focus, touching on 'Field Recordings', Blues, Gospel, Religious and early R and B, but also surveying white popular and jazz and swing influenced music, primarily before 1950. Other ethnic and cultural recordings, esoteric recordings, instrumental recordings, vaudeville, dialect comedy and other recorded artifacts from the early years of recorded music also find their way into the show. The recordings themselves are primarily from original source material, primarily 78rpm discs, but also 33rpm discs and, also analog and digital transcriptions of original recordings. The show educates as it entertains and unfolds historic and social themes as related to the music. I try, each show, to, besides informing listeners of the specific dates of the recordings and the musical personnel featured, mention other related information of historical settings or background. However, the program is primarily music presented in a chronological format, which hopefully progresses in a way which leads the listener to their own conclusions. Though I put hours of thought and preparation into each show, with specific musical, and other intentions, it is mostly up to the listener to interpret what they hear. The show begins, proceeds and ends and hopefully, however much of the show a listener might hear on a given day, from part of one song to the whole show, they are enlightened in some way. Because of the historic and sometimes, rare nature of the recordings presented, it is most likely, that, despite the fact that these are older recordings, the listener will be hearing some, or perhaps, most of this music for the first time. Certainly, much of this music is very rarely heard on the airwaves, anywhere.
